102: Run a Facebook Ad Already

Facebook Ads Course, Live Help 4/29!We talk about why “visibility” feels worse than ever for family photographers and why going viral rarely leads to steady local bookings. We share a simple, hyperlocal Facebook ads approach that builds trust fast, warms people up through repetition, and turns clicks into real sessions. • why viral posts often attract other photographers instead of local clients • updating the “always run an ad” advice to focus on hyperlocal, offer-specific ads • why you do not need an ads manager for a simple local campaign • the biggest reasons photographers’ Facebook ads flop: generic copy, weak CTA, wrong destination, stopping too soon • how runway works and why six weeks is a better minimum than one week • what a high-trust landing page needs so people can book without DMs • a practical local setup: radius targeting, strong creative, location-specific language, $1 to $10 daily budget • how repetition warms leads and can lift your organic visibility too My Instagram + My Membership

101: The Six-Week Booking Sprint for Spring

90 Minute Marketing IntensiveI lay out a six-week booking sprint for family photographers who look at their spring calendar and feel that sinking “uh oh” moment. We also dig into the debate about showing kids’ faces online and why fear-based, black-and-white rules can hurt photographers and families when the real issue is nuance and privacy.• spring booking sprint built around visibility, trust, and ease of booking• why we avoid rebranding, website overhauls, and portfolio spirals during slow season• the kids’ faces online debate, AI fears, and the difference between identity-based exposure and anonymous portfolio work• one offer only and one clear booking path to reduce confusion and increase conversions• week one foundation: clear page, simple pricing, examples, and fast inquiry replies• week two visibility push with local tags, storytelling, and direct invites to book• week three trust builders: testimonials, FAQs, and a simple booking walk-through video• week four urgency: scarcity language, availability posts, and reminders without shame• week five follow-up: tracking leads and converting fence sitters• week six evaluate: double down on what works, pivot if needed, keep momentumIf you need help with this, you can join the membership.
